一种打分系统的双机热备的切换方法及系统的制作方法

文档序号:7943352阅读:344来源:国知局
专利名称:一种打分系统的双机热备的切换方法及系统的制作方法
技术领域
本发明涉及竞技比赛转播、直播打分类节目制作领域中,应用于竞技比赛现场计分数据的调用及处理系统中,特别涉及一种打分系统的双机热备的切换方法及系统。
背景技术
随着电视转播技术的发展,电视直播类节目成为电视节目的重要组成部分,特别是对于打分类的电视转播在近年来得到了长足的发展,其发展不仅涉及电视领域中,并且更广泛的涉及分布式网络及移动存储领域中,在竞技比赛或打分类节目的直播过程中,通常需要对现场数据进行现场即时处理,为了保证播出质量,对于现场系统的可靠性提出了较高的要求,由于是节目转播现场,通常情况下现场系统的搭建都是临时进行的,因此,现场系统的可靠性会受到各种因素的影响,为了避免外界因素及系统因素给现场系统带来的 不稳定性,现有技术中通常采用备份数据库的方式,防止现场数据的丢失,但是上述方法通常会带来的问题是,需要额外的添加数据库设备,并且由于数据库设备的切换需要一定切换时间,因此,在切换过程中会造出现场输入数据的丢失,造成现场输入数据的丢失及输出错误。在发明人实现本发明过程中,发现现有技术中有以下缺陷,现有技术中采用在系统中备份数据库的方法,在系统出现故障需要切换时,要进行数据库及服务器或处理器的同时切换,需要较长的切换时间,从而在切换过程造成的数据丢失,特别是以上问题出现在现场类打分系统中时,将会直接影响到节目的播出效果,增大现场数据错误的概率。

发明内容
针对现有技术中的缺陷,本发明解决了打分系统中由于系统故障不能对打分数据端进行数据处理的问题。为了解决以上技术问题本发明提供了一种打分系统的双机热备的切换方法,包括通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障;当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信;当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。同时,本发明提供一种打分系统的双机热备的切换系统,包括,接收单元,主备切换单元,其中所述接收单元,用于通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障;所述主备切换单元,用于当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信;当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。与现有技术相比,本发明实施例具有以下优点通过在原打分系统中增加打分服务器作为备打分服务器,原打分服务器作为主打分服务器,当主打分服务器出现故障时,监控设备通过网络交换设备从主打分服务器切换到备打分服务器,在此切换过程中,不需要进行数据的转存和切换,使用较短的切换时间就可实现从主打分服务器到备打分服务器的转换,并在此过程中由于不需要转存数据,因此不会造成现场数据的丢失,增大了打分系统处理数据的可靠性,和数据处理效率,更好的满足了现场打分系统的应用要求。



为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。图I :是本发明实施例中一种打分系统双机热备的系统结构组成图;图2 :是本发明实施例中一种打分系统的双机热备的切换方法的流程图;图3 :是本发明实施例中一种打分系统的双机热备的切换系统的示意图。
具体实施例方式下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然所描述的实施例是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。本发明实施例I中提供了一种打分系统的双机热备的切换方法,如图2所示,在本实施例中打分系统,至少包括网络交换机、打分输入端、打分服务器及数据库,所述打分数据端、服务器及所述数据库与所述网络交换机连接,其实际打分系统结构图如图I所示,具体包括SlOl :接收主打分服务器检测信息;此步骤具体为通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障;S102 :判断是否切换;此步骤具体为当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信;当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。本发明实施例2中提供了另一种打分系统的双机热备的切换方法,所述打分系统中包括网络交换机、打分输入端、打分服务器及数据库,所述打分数据端、服务器及所述数据库与所述网络交换机连接,具体包括所述网络交换机具体包括有线网络交换机和/或无线网络交换机。S201 :通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障;所述主打分服务器检测信息中具体包括电源容量检测值。S202:当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信;当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。 以上步骤还具体包括所述判断所述主打分服务器检测信息是否异常步骤具体包括接收电源容量检测阀值;判断所述电源容量检测值是否地域所述电源容量检测阀值,若是,则所述主打分服务器检测信息异常,否则,所述信息正常。以上步骤中所述打分数据中具体包括打分数据标识,当通过所述网络交换机接收来自备打分服务器的打分数据,所述打分数据标识为备打分数据,当通过所述网络交换机接收来自所述主打分服务器的打分数据,所述打分数据标识为主打分数据。S203:当所述主打分服务器检测信息为异常时,判断所述网络交换机与所述主打分服务器之间的通信是否恢复,如果已恢复,则通过所述网络交换机接收来自所述主打分服务器的打分数据。以上步骤后还可以进一步包括根据所述打分数据生成字幕文件;在播控系统中根据所述字幕文件进行字幕播放。本发明实施例3中提供了一种打分系统的双机热备的切换系统,如图3所示,所述打分系统中包括所述打分系统中包括网络交换机、打分输入端、打分服务器及数据库,所述打分数据端、服务器及所述数据库与所述网络交换机连接,具体包括,接收单元301,主备切换单元302,其中,有线网络交换机和/或无线网络交换机;所述数据库为关系型数据库。所述接收单元301,用于用于通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障;所述主备切换单元302,当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信;当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据;其中,所述主打分服务器检测信息中具体包括电源容量检测值,进而,主备切换单元302还具体包电源检测单元3021,其中,所述电源检测单元3021,用于接收电源容量检测阀值;判断所述电源容量检测值是否地域所述电源容量检测阀值,若是,则所述主打分服务器检测信息异常,否则,所述信息正常。所述打分数据中具体包括打分数据标识,当通过所述网络交换机接收来自备打分服务器的打分数据,所述打分数据标识为备打分数据,当通过所述网络交换机接收来自所述主打分服务器的打分数据,所述打分数据标识为主打分数据。在以上系统中还可以进一步包括,恢复单元303 所述恢复单元303,用于当所述主打分服务器检测信息为异常时,判断所述网络交换机与所述主打分服务器之间的通信是否恢复,如果已恢复,则通过所述网络交换机接收来自所述主打分服务器的打分数据。以上系统还进一步包括字幕生成单元304及播放单元305,所述字幕生成单元304,用于根据所述打分数据生成字幕文件;所述播放单元305,用于在播控系统中根据所述字幕文件进行字幕播放。通过以上的实施方式的描述,本领域的技术人员可以清楚地了解到本发明可以通过硬件实现,也可以借助软件加必要的通用硬件平台的方式来实现。基于这样的理解,本发明的技术方案可以以软件产品的形式体现出来,该软件产品可以存储在一个非易失性存储介质(可以是⑶-ROM,U盘,移动硬盘等)中,包括若干指令用以使得一台计算机设备(可 以是个人计算机,服务器,或者网络设备等)执行本发明各个实施例所述的方法。本领域技术人员可以理解附图只是一个优选实施例的示意图,附图中的模块或流程并不一定是实施本发明所必须的。本领域技术人员可以理解实施例中的装置中的模块可以按照实施例描述进行分布于实施例的装置中,也可以进行相应变化位于不同于本实施例的一个或多个装置中。上述实施例的模块可以合并为一个模块,也可以进一步拆分成多个子模块。上述本发明实施例序号仅仅为了描述,不代表实施例的优劣。以上公开的仅为本发明的几个具体实施例,但是,本发明并非局限于此,任何本领域的技术人员能思之的变化都应落入本发明的保护范围。
权利要求
1.一种打分系统的双机热备的切换方法,其特征在于,包括 通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障; 当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信; 当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。
2.如权利要求I中所述的方法,其特征在于,所述当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据步骤后还具体包括 当所述主打分服务器检测信息为异常时,判断所述网络交换机与所述主打分服务器之间的通信是否恢复,如果已恢复,则通过所述网络交换机接收来自所述主打分服务器的打分数据。
3.如权利要求I中所述的方法,其特征在于,所述主打分服务器检测信息中具体包括电源容量检测值。
4.如权利要求3中所述的方法,其特征在于,所述判断所述主打分服务器检测信息是否异常步骤具体包括 接收电源容量检测阀值; 判断所述电源容量检测值是否地域所述电源容量检测阀值,若是,则所述主打分服务器检测信息异常,否则,所述信息正常。
5.如权利要求I中所述的方法,其特征在于,所述打分数据中具体包括打分数据标识,当通过所述网络交换机接收来自备打分服务器的打分数据,所述打分数据标识为备打分数据,当通过所述网络交换机接收来自所述主打分服务器的打分数据,所述打分数据标识为主打分数据。
6.如权利要求I中所述的方法,其特征在于,所述当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据步骤后还具体包括 根据所述打分数据生成字幕文件; 在播控系统中根据所述字幕文件进行字幕播放。
7.一种打分系统的双机热备的切换系统,其特征在于,包括,接收单元,主备切换单元,其中 所述接收单元,用于通过网络交换机转发来自主打分服务器的检测信息,所述检测信息用于检测所述网络交换机与所述主打分服务器之间通信是否故障; 所述主备切换单元,用于当所述主打分服务器检测信息为异常时,则通过所述网络交换机接收来自备打分服务器的打分数据,并通过所述网络交换机向所述主打分服务器发送恢复信息,所述恢复信息用于恢复所述网络交换机与所述主打分服务器之间的通信; 当所述主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据。
8.如权利要求7中所述的系统,其特征在于,所述系统中还包括恢复单元,所述恢复单元,用于当所述主打分服务器检测信息为异常时,判断所述网络交换机与所述主打分服务器之间的通信是否恢复,如果已恢复,则通过所述网络交换机接收来自所述主打分服务器的打分数据。
9.如权利要求7中所述的系统,其特征在于,所述主打分服务器检测信息中具体包括电源容量检测值。
10.如权利要求9中所述的系统,其特征在于,主备切换单元还具体包电源检测单元,其中, 所述电源检测单元,用于接收电源容量检测阀值; 判断所述电源容量检测值是否地域所述电源容量检测阀值,若是,则所述主打分服务器检测信息异常,否则,所述信息正常。
11.如权利要求7中所述的系统,其特征在于,所述打分数据中具体包括打分数据标 识,当通过所述网络交换机接收来自备打分服务器的打分数据,当过所述网络交换机接收来自所述主打分服务器的打分数据,所述打分数据标识为主打分数据。
12.如权利要求7中所述的系统,其特征在于,还包括,字幕生成单元及播放单元,所述字幕生成单元,用于根据所述打分数据生成字幕文件;所述播放单元,用于在播控系统中根据所述字幕文件进行字幕播放。
全文摘要
本发明公开了一种打分系统的双机热备的切换方法,包括通过网络交换机转发来自主打分服务器的检测信息,当主打分服务器检测信息为异常时,则通过网络交换机接收来自备打分服务器的打分数据,并通过网络交换机向主打分服务器发送恢复信息,当主打分服务器检测信息为正常时,则通过所述网络交换机接收来自所述主打分服务器的打分数据,以上方法解决了打分系统中由于系统故障不能对打分数据端进行数据处理的问题,使用较短的切换时间就可实现从主打分服务器到备打分服务器的转换,并在此过程中由于不需要转存数据,因此不会造成现场数据的丢失,增大了打分系统处理数据的可靠性,和数据处理效率,更好的满足了现场打分系统的应用要求。
文档编号H04L12/26GK102752164SQ20111031857
公开日2012年10月24日 申请日期2011年10月19日 优先权日2011年10月19日
发明者王征, 赵海军 申请人:新奥特(北京)视频技术有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1